At UAGC, the Bachelor of Arts in Homeland Security and Emergency Management program prepares you to effectively manage and respond to emergencies and security issues. You will gain a thorough understanding of risk assessment, incident management, and recovery strategies. This program emphasizes both theoretical and practical skills, ensuring you are ready to make informed decisions in critical situations.
You will engage with coursework that covers disaster response, terrorism, and cyber threats, preparing you for a range of complex challenges. With a focus on leadership and communication, this degree equips you to work in government agencies, private organizations, or non-profit sectors. The curriculum is designed to enhance your critical thinking and problem-solving abilities, essential for securing communities and managing emergencies effectively.

According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), the median annual wage for emergency management directors was $82,200 in May 2022. The lowest 10 percent earned less than $50,850, while the highest 10 percent earned more than $135,470. These figures provide a realistic expectation of earnings for graduates of programs like the BA in Homeland Security and Emergency Management.

The BA in Homeland Security and Emergency Management from UAGC typically takes about four years to complete for full-time students. Part-time options may extend the duration, while transfer students could finish faster based on previous coursework. This program prepares you to manage critical situations with confidence and skill.
